Sara Poyzer and Richard Standing return as Donna and Sam in a new West End cast for Mamma Mia! from 12 October, and booking now runs to 2 October 2027.
Sara Poyzer returns as Donna and Richard Standing as Sam when a new cast takes over Mamma Mia! at the Novello Theatre on Monday 12 October 2026. Booking has been extended to 2 October 2027, with those tickets on sale today.
Poyzer was last seen on the Come From Away UK tour and Standing in Faith Healer at Pitlochry Festival Theatre. They are joined by Vivien Carter (Anything Goes at the Barbican) as Tanya and Laura Medforth (Muriel’s Wedding at Curve) as Rosie, with Daniel Crowder as Harry and Rakesh Boury, lately of Matilda the Musical in the West End, as Bill.
Ellie Gilbert-Grey plays Sophie after Freaky Friday the Musical at Home Manchester, opposite Kyle Cox as Sky, who has been touring in &Juliet. Natorii Illidge (Moulin Rouge! The Musical) is Ali and Foxy Valentine is Lisa, with Edward Turner as Eddie and Charlie Garton as Pepper. Emma Odell plays Donna at certain performances.

The show turned 27 in April and is now the third longest-running musical in West End history. It opened at the Prince Edward Theatre in 1999, moved to the Prince of Wales Theatre in 2004 and has been at the Novello since 2012, playing close to 11,000 performances in London to more than 11 million people.
Catherine Johnson wrote the book, with music and lyrics by Benny Andersson and Björn Ulvaeus. Phyllida Lloyd directs and Anthony Van Laast choreographs, with set and costume design by Mark Thompson, lighting by Howard Harrison, sound by Andrew Bruce and Bobby Aitken, and musical supervision and arrangements by Martin Koch. It is produced by Judy Craymer, Richard East and Ulvaeus for Littlestar in association with Universal Music Group.
Tickets start at £20. Early Bird pricing takes £20 off Band B, Band A and Premium seats for Monday to Thursday performances booked at least twelve weeks ahead, and a family rate covers four people from £99. Over-60s can get seats normally priced up to £98.50 for £37.50 at selected Thursday matinees, and group rates apply from ten people. There is a captioned performance on 16 January 2027 and an audio-described performance with touch tour on 23 January, both at 3pm.
Mamma Mia! runs at the Novello Theatre, Aldwych, Monday to Saturday at 7.30pm with Thursday and Saturday matinees at 3pm. The new cast joins on Monday 12 October 2026 and the production is now booking to Saturday 2 October 2027. Running time is 2 hours 35 minutes including the interval.
